Skip to main content

Agent-based modeling in Python

Project description

Agentpy - Agent-based modeling in Python

Agentpy is a package for the development and analysis of agent-based models in Python. The project is still in an early stage of development. If you need help or want to contribute, feel free to write me via joel.foramitti@uab.cat.

Main features:

  • Design of agent-based models with complex procedures.
  • Creation of custom agent types, environments, and networks.
  • Container classes for operations on groups of agents and environments.
  • Experiments with repeated iterations, large parameter samples, and distinct scenarios.
  • Output data that can be saved, loaded, and transformed for further analysis.
  • Tools for sensitivity analysis, interactive output, animations, and plots.

Documentation: https://agentpy.readthedocs.io

Model library: https://agentpy.readthedocs.io/en/latest/models.html

Requirements: Python 3, NumPy, scipy, matplotlib, networkx, pandas, SALib, and ipywidgets.

Installation: pip install agentpy

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

agentpy-0.0.3.tar.gz (16.7 kB view details)

Uploaded Source

Built Distribution

agentpy-0.0.3-py3-none-any.whl (20.1 kB view details)

Uploaded Python 3

File details

Details for the file agentpy-0.0.3.tar.gz.

File metadata

  • Download URL: agentpy-0.0.3.tar.gz
  • Upload date:
  • Size: 16.7 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/2.0.0 pkginfo/1.5.0.1 requests/2.24.0 setuptools/47.3.0.post20200616 requests-toolbelt/0.9.1 tqdm/4.50.2 CPython/3.7.7

File hashes

Hashes for agentpy-0.0.3.tar.gz
Algorithm Hash digest
SHA256 46494f065ae12719e6da255c05b3a86499029d399562089855395527ca85a396
MD5 a722db69599b99378691e32d3a114e71
BLAKE2b-256 38938e2c8b45cf0ef7a8925bbdecdf8034840bfb2c75d667d1fdf4ac71a8842f

See more details on using hashes here.

File details

Details for the file agentpy-0.0.3-py3-none-any.whl.

File metadata

  • Download URL: agentpy-0.0.3-py3-none-any.whl
  • Upload date:
  • Size: 20.1 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/2.0.0 pkginfo/1.5.0.1 requests/2.24.0 setuptools/47.3.0.post20200616 requests-toolbelt/0.9.1 tqdm/4.50.2 CPython/3.7.7

File hashes

Hashes for agentpy-0.0.3-py3-none-any.whl
Algorithm Hash digest
SHA256 85960b247c60f615d22aa8e10079aae08d25e67c8c7676b43746fcfd9ff93cd3
MD5 79c84f3b1a76d47d43735cf3119a486b
BLAKE2b-256 b18259079139d67e99cbd2b987081bcb2a9470f304db0fb84727a6f3e1e2de8c

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page